LogMeIn features and specs

  • Ease of Use
    LogMeIn offers a user-friendly interface, making it easy for both technical and non-technical users to navigate and use the software for remote access.
  • High Security
    The software provides robust security features, including TLS 1.2 transport security, dual passwords, and two-factor authentication, ensuring that remote sessions are secure.
  • Cross-Platform Compatibility
    LogMeIn supports multiple platforms, including Windows, macOS, iOS, and Android, making it versatile for users with different devices.
  • Advanced Features
    The service includes advanced features like remote printing, file transfer, and multi-monitor support, which are beneficial for professional and business users.
  • Scalability
    LogMeIn is suitable for both individual users and large teams, offering plans that can scale according to the number of users and required features.

Possible disadvantages of LogMeIn

  • Cost
    LogMeIn can be expensive compared to other remote access solutions, which might not be ideal for users with a limited budget.
  • Performance Issues
    Some users have reported occasional performance issues, such as lag or slow connections, which can be problematic during critical tasks.
  • No Free Version
    Unlike some competitors, LogMeIn does not offer a free version, limiting access for users who are not willing or able to pay for a subscription.
  • Resource Heavy
    The software can consume significant system resources, potentially impacting the performance of the host and remote devices during sessions.
  • Complex Setup
    Initial setup can be complex, particularly for less tech-savvy users, sometimes requiring additional time and effort to get everything configured correctly.

Node.js features and specs

  • Asynchronous and Event-Driven
    Node.js uses an asynchronous, non-blocking, and event-driven I/O model, making it efficient and scalable for handling multiple simultaneous connections.
  • JavaScript Everywhere
    Developers can use JavaScript for both client-side and server-side programming, providing a unified language environment and better synergy between front-end and back-end development.
  • Large Community and NPM
    Node.js has a vibrant community and a rich ecosystem with the Node Package Manager (NPM), which offers thousands of open-source libraries and tools that can be integrated easily into projects.
  • High Performance
    Built on the V8 JavaScript engine from Google, Node.js translates JavaScript directly into native machine code, which increases performance and speed.
  • Scalability
    Designed with microservices and scalability in mind, Node.js enables easy horizontal scaling across multiple servers.
  • JSON Support
    Node.js seamlessly handles JSON, which is a common format for API responses, making it an excellent choice for building RESTful APIs and data-intensive real-time applications.

Possible disadvantages of Node.js

  • Callback Hell
    The reliance on callbacks to manage asynchronous operations can lead to deeply nested and difficult-to-read code, commonly referred to as 'Callback Hell'.
  • Not Suitable for CPU-Intensive Tasks
    Node.js is optimized for I/O operations and can become inefficient for CPU-intensive tasks, slowing down overall performance due to its single-threaded event loop.
  • Immaturity of Tools
    Compared to more established technologies, some Node.js libraries and tools still lack maturity and comprehensive documentation, which can be challenging for developers.
  • Callback and Promise Overheads
    Managing asynchronous operations using callbacks or promises can lead to additional complexity and overhead, impacting maintainability and performance if not handled correctly.
  • Fragmented Ecosystem
    The fast-paced evolution of Node.js and its ecosystem can lead to fragmentation, with numerous versions and libraries that may not always be compatible with each other.
  • Security Issues
    The extensive use of third-party libraries via NPM can introduce security vulnerabilities if not properly managed and updated, making applications more susceptible to attacks.

Analysis of Node.js

Overall verdict

  • Node.js is a popular and effective choice for building a wide range of applications, from small utilities to large-scale enterprise solutions. Its performance, speed, and community support make it a strong option, especially for real-time applications.

Why this product is good

  • Node.js is considered good because it's built on Google Chrome's V8 JavaScript Engine, making it fast and efficient for handling I/O operations. Its event-driven, non-blocking I/O model makes it suitable for building scalable network applications. Additionally, it has a large ecosystem of packages available through npm, allowing developers to find solutions for almost any problem they might encounter.

Recommended for

  • Web applications with a lot of I/O operations
  • Real-time services such as chat applications
  • APIs for mobile and single-page applications
  • Prototyping and agile development
  • Microservices architecture
